> On 08/11/2010 01:12 AM, BJ Freeman wrote:
> > in general, the business logic for purchase orders is different from
> > sales orders.
> > the default way ofbiz is setup purchase orders are based on stock
> > levels. There is a flag for drop ship that changes this but only created
> > the PO not emails itself.
> > also you want this to happen only after an sales order is approved, not
> > when it is created.
> > to create a email for PO just follow the data for sales order emails in
> > the demo data.
> > then you can put in an SECA to trigger on the service that create the
> > purchase order.
